Gillig Recalls 2011-2022 Low Floor 29-Foot Buses Due to Suspension Defect

Gillig is recalling 2011-2022 Low Floor 29-foot transit buses because the rear suspension lower control arm may fail, increasing crash risk.

Plain-English summary

Gillig, LLC is recalling certain 2011-2022 Low Floor 29-foot CNG, diesel hybrid, and electric transit buses. The recall involves 435 vehicles.

The rear suspension lower control arm may fail. Failure of a lower control arm can result in a loss of vehicle control, increasing the risk of a crash.

Dealers will replace the lower control arm free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ed April 19, 2024. Owners may contact Gillig customer service at 1-510-264-5073 or 1-800-735-1500, or the NHTSA Vehicle Safety Hotline at 1-888-327-4236.
